Tile Assistant information

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a tile assistant on a job site?

As a Tile Assistant, your day-to-day tasks often include preparing surfaces for tiling, mixing adhesives or grout, cutting tiles to fit specific spaces, and assisting the main tiler with layout and installation. You'll also be responsible for maintaining a clean work area and handling tools or materials safely. Collaboration is key, as you'll frequently work alongside experienced tilers and other construction professionals to ensure projects are completed efficiently and to a high standard.

What is the difference between Tile Assistant vs Tile Setter?

AspectTile AssistantTile Setter
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ma; apprenticeship or vocational training often required
Work EnvironmentAssist in tile installation, prepare materials, and support tile settersPerform actual tile installation, cutting, and finishing work
Industry UsageSupport role in construction and renovation projectsLead role responsible for installing tiles in residential and commercial settings

The main difference between a Tile Assistant and a Tile Setter is that the Tile Assistant supports and prepares for tile installation, while the Tile Setter performs the actual installation work. Tile Assistants typically have less experience and training, focusing on assisting experienced Tile Setters. Both roles are essential in the tile installation process, with the Assistant serving as a support role to ensure efficiency and quality.

What is a tile assistant?

Tile Assistants are workers who support tilers or tile setters in installing tiles on floors, walls, and other surfaces. Their duties typically include preparing surfaces, mixing adhesives, cutting tiles, and cleaning up work areas. Tile Assistants help ensure that tile installations are completed efficiently and meet quality standards. They may also assist in transporting materials and tools, measuring and marking surfaces, and following safety procedures on job sites.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a tile ass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Tile Assistant, you need basic knowledge of tiling techniques, manual dexterity, and physical stamina, often gained through on-the-job training or apprenticeships. Familiarity with tools like tile cutters, grout floats, and levels, as well as adherence to safety procedures, is typically required. Attention to detail, reliability, and effective teamwork are valuable so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ities help ensure precise tile installation, smooth workflow, and a safe, productive job site.
